What companies run services between Heuston, Ireland and Howth Road, Ireland?

Iarnród Éireann (Irish Rail) operates a train from Tara Street to Clontarf Road every 10 minutes. Tickets cost €1–3 and the journey takes 7 min. Alternatively, Dublin Bus operates a bus from Busáras to Clontarf Road Station every 10 minutes. Tickets cost €3 and the journey takes 11 min.
